Akelius purchases brondesbury court for £6.5m

Swedish property group continues to grow UK residential portfolio

Advised by CBRE, the Swedish property group Akelius has completed the purchase of Brondesbury Court in North West London from Grainger for £6.65 million.

Brondesbury Court is a 1930’s four-storey, purpose built residential block comprising 18 apartments with off-street parking and substantial grounds to the rear of the property. It also has planning permission for the creation of four two-bedroom flats with private terraces on the fourth floor, which will enhance the scheme’s income.

Located on the border of Brondesbury and Willesden Green, Brondesbury Court is approximately an eight minute walk from Willesden Green Underground Station on the Jubilee Line providing rapid access to the West End, The City and Canary Wharf.

The acquisition of Brondesbury Court follows one of the largest residential property transactions in recent years when Akelius purchased a portfolio of 574 apartments from Terrace Hill for £75.35 million in March.

Lars Lindfors, Managing Director of Akelius UK, said:

“Brondesbury Court fits within our core remit of acquiring residential property in popular London boroughs that is well-located for local amenities and close to transport. We are on course to reach our target of acquiring 1,000 residential units in the UK by the end of the year and our refurbishment works on the properties we have already bought are well underway. This includes installing new kitchens and bathrooms, renovating the common areas and landscaping grounds to ensure that our UK portfolio meets Akelius Living standard.”

Chris Lacey, Head of Residential Investment and Funding, CBRE, said:

“Akelius has now invested around £100 million in acquiring and refurbishing property in London and the South East of England, since the fund entered the market at the end of last year. We are continuing to work with Akelius to identify suitable acquisitions for its UK portfolio.”

Akelius owns a total of 35,000 residential properties in Sweden, Germany, England and Canada with an assessed market value of £3.1 billion.
